The plugin reads your WooCommerce products (including variations, categories and _stock / _stock_status meta) and pushes a structured menu/catalog to the marketplace via its merchant API. Real-time stock and price updates are driven by WooCommerce hooks (woocommerce_product_set_stock, woocommerce_variation_set_stock, woocommerce_update_product) so a sale or price edit in wp-admin propagates outward within seconds, with a WP-Cron reconciliation sweep as a safety net against missed webhooks.
Inbound, marketplace orders are ingested as native WooCommerce orders through a custom REST endpoint, written via the CRUD layer so they are fully HPOS (custom order tables) compatible — they appear in WooCommerce → Orders with the correct line items, branch and a marketplace order reference stored in order meta. Branch/location-based availability maps each physical store or dark-store to its own catalog and stock pool, so the right SKUs show for the right location. Delivery-status transitions flow back as WooCommerce order-status changes and order notes, keeping your team and your reporting accurate.
Built on the WooCommerce REST API, standard WordPress actions/filters and a dedicated settings screen under WooCommerce, it is designed to coexist with your theme, WPML and multisite without core hacks.
